What's Happening?
Tommy White, the Athletics' No. 7 prospect, hit a grand slam during an Arizona Fall League game for the Mesa team. This marked his second home run in the Fall League, showcasing his potential as a rising
star in baseball. The grand slam occurred in the second inning, contributing significantly to his team's performance in the league.
